Dynamo – Русский – только для чтения
Раздел для программистов и специалистов, использующих Dynamo
c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

Центробежный вентилятор и Dynamo

3 REPLIES 3
SOLVED
Reply
Message 1 of 4
Anonymous
1319 Views, 3 Replies

Центробежный вентилятор и Dynamo

Суть вопроса такова. Есть семейство центробежного вентилятора, улитка которого может быть повернута на определенный угол. Хочу через динамо, пустое свойство (наименование вентилятора) заполнять как конкотонацию определенных параметров - "ВР-88-72.1-5.4-03 Пр 0°".

 

Где "ВР-88-72.1-5.4-03" - название вентилятора

      "Пр" - конструктивное исполнение вентилятора

       0° - угол поворота улитки

Есть несколько вопросов:

- Как объединить параметры с разделителями, например "_" или "-"?

- как в параметре "угол поворота" убрать нули после запятой и получить целое число?

- непонятно в каких единицах динамо выводит параметр N, нужны киловатты.

Все видно на скрине скрипта.

 

А учитывая, что в проекте могут быть несколько вентиляторов, то в Динамо должен быть еще скрипт, с каким-то циклом, который перебирает значения всех вентиляторов и для каждого возвращает его наименование.

3 REPLIES 3
Message 2 of 4
semko_dm
in reply to: Anonymous

Добрый день!

На счет нулей после запятой можно посмотреть <в этом посте>

Что касается единиц, установите версию динамо посвежее, на сколько я помню, в старых версиях было необходимо вводить коэффициенты при использовании значений из ревита, в новых такого нет.
Для объединения параметров с разделителем нужно значения всех параметров преобразовать в строки, если они ими не являются, и воспользоваться нодом для объединения строк.
Для того чтобы заполнить параметр экземпляра для всех экземпляров нужно выбрать все экземпляры семейства в проекте(простите за тафтологию=)

В прикрепленном файле можно посмотреть пример, использовался динамо версии 1,2

Если данный пост дал ответ на ваш вопрос, примите его в качестве решения, чтобы остальным было проще его найти.
С уважением,
Дмитирй Семко.



Dmitriy Semko
BIM-Manager
Blog
Facebook | Telegram | LinkedIn

Tags (2)
Message 3 of 4
alexey.lobanov
in reply to: semko_dm

Никаких циклов не надо в Динамо. Он сам перебирает списки.

 

Любые параметры соединяются примерно одним и тем-же способом.


Alexey Lobanov / Алексей Лобанов
Revit Architecture Certified Professional | Autodesk Certified Instructor | Autodesk Expert Elite
PRORUBIM | YouTube channel | LinkedIn profile

Message 4 of 4
Anonymous
in reply to: Anonymous

Спасибо, получилось. Только с единицами измерения все никак. Будем ждать пока системщики обновят нам Динамо до 1.2 версии

Can't find what you're looking for? Ask the community or share your knowledge.

Post to forums  

Autodesk Design & Make Report